LOT  182d

                                               (Coloured Pink on Plan No. 2)
                                     A STONE-BUILT, SLATE ROOF

                 MODEL COTTAGE WITH GARDEN

                                     “WESTMINSTER  COTTAGES”


               Situate in “The Ring,” in the Town of STALBRIDGE, forming part of No. 496 on Plan,
                                                extending to about
                                                0 a.    2 r.   39 p.
                                                      (0.740 Acre)

               Containing Sitting Room, Kitchen, Three Bedrooms, and Wash-house and good Garden.
                                   Let to Mr. W. Pearce on a Quarterly Tenancy.
                  Sold subject to the existing water rights and easements in lease to Messrs. C. & G. Prideaux, Ltd.

            LANDLORD’S OUTGOINGS:-Commuted Tithe Rent, £0  5s.  4d., Value (1918)      £0   5  10
                                                    Land Tax       ...        ...        ...       ...        ...       ...         (as assessed).
                  NOTE.- The Vendor has arranged to grant a Lease to Mr. W. Pearce for 21 years, if he so long live.
